The Importance of Avoiding Interruptions
Interruptions can have a significant impact on your productivity. Research has shown that it can take up to 23 minutes to regain your focus after being interrupted. This means that even a brief interruption can derail your train of thought and make it difficult to get back on track. In addition, interruptions can lead to errors, decreased job satisfaction, and increased stress levels.
